RxCheck Logo

RxConsole User Guide

Version 3.2 · State PDMP Administrator
Contact Us

SRS Outbound Sender Endpoint

This section enlists the standards and interfaces that are supported by the RxCheck application for all request and response transactions. This step allows State PDMP Administrators to select/enter specific details pertaining to their unique PDMP site environment.

Currently, RxConsole supports the following interfaces:

A brief description of each type of interface is listed below:

To configure the SRS Outbound Sender Endpoint section, the State PDMP Administrator must enter the requested information into the active data fields that fall under this section. All URL Paths and Outbound URLs for each interface are auto populated. Should there be any questions or concerns, please contact the RxCheck technical team for further assistance.

The following Screenshot depicts the configuration process for the SRS Outbound Sender Endpoint section. For additional clarity, the ensuing table provides a definition of each data field present in the screenshot.

HeadingData Field NameDescription
Protocol

Protocols define a standardized set of rules for formatting and handling data during transmission.

State PDMP Administrators must select one of the following options from the dropdown menu:

  • HTTP (HyperText Transfer Protocol) – A basic protocol used for transmitting text-based data between a client (e.g. browser) and a server. HTTP does not provide encryption, making it less secure for transmitting sensitive information.
  • HTTPS (HyperText Transfer Protocol Secure) – An enhanced version of HTTP that uses encryption and authentication mechanisms. HTTPS ensures secure communication by leveraging Secure Socket Layer (SSL) or Transport Layer Security (TLS), and is the recommended protocol for transmitting PDMP data within the RxCheck infrastructure.
  • DomainThe domain name of the server on which the SRS is running.

    This field is optional – If no domain is specified the system will use the IP Address.

    E.g. New Jersey: NJ.gov

    Port NumberA port is a communication endpoint, and a port number is a logical number assigned to it. The port number indicates the dedicated port that will be used by the SRS software for communication purposes.

    Port numbers are used to direct incoming network traffic to the appropriate process or service on a server, ensuring that messages reach the correct application for handling.

    IP AddressAn Internet Protocol (IP) Address is a unique numerical identifier assigned to each device that is connected to a network that uses the Internet Protocol for communication.

    The IP Address field is populated as "localhost" by default.

    HeadingData Field NameDescription
    NIEMPMIX Outbound URLA fully qualified URL for the NIEM Service on Outbound SRS.

    This field is auto-populated.

    NCPDP-2017NCPDP-2017 Outbound URLA fully qualified URL for the NCPDP 2017 Service on Outbound SRS.

    This field is auto-populated.

    HL7 FHIRFHIR Outbound URLA fully qualified URL for the FHIR Service on Outbound SRS.

    This field is auto-populated.

    HTMLHTML Outbound URLA fully qualified URL for the HTML Service on Outbound SRS.

    This field is auto-populated.

    Security Credentials: (HTTP Basic Authentication)Outbound UsernameA username to authenticate the SRS connection on the RxCheck network.
    Security Credentials: (HTTP Basic Authentication)Outbound PasswordA password to authenticate the SRS connection on the RxCheck network.
    ×